TMPAD
TMPAD lets you run your games at a lower resolution to get a smoother experience
It supports both root and shizuku on any A13+ device

EXİF İmage & Video Date Fixer
EXIF Image & Video Date Fixer is an Android app that restores the proper chronological order of your media gallery by correcting file dates after transfers, backups, or cloud downloads. By using EXIF metadata and filename parsing, it intelligently repairs out-of-sequence photos and videos—bringing your memories back into perfect order.

Here’s the stories for the week:
No anonymous apps: The biggest Android news this year, Google decides to wall off Android from anonymous developers and have complete control over apps on Android. This is the fracturing of the tech movement, starting in 2027.
FCC Shuts Down 1,000 VoIP Providers: Use a VoIP service? A thousand US VoIP companies will be forced to stop service August 28th by the FCC for not following RoboCall guidelines. Learn how this works and check if yours is on the list.
US Attorney Generals Warn AI: On the heels of Meta’s Internal AI leak, 44 US Attorney generals wrote a strongly worded letter to major AI companies.
Solutions: Uncensored AI - Enoch AI: A new AI project by Brighteon has trained its AI on sources of natural health information, and you can start using it today.
